Travlin' Man by Stevie Wonder (with song lyrics)
Stevie Wonder
Travlin' Man

Year: 1967
RecordLabel: Tamla 54147
ChartPosition: R&B #31, US #32
Writtenby: Ronald Miller [Ronald Norman Miller] (as Ron Miller) and Bryan Wells
Comments: [Motown Sound]
